How Shopify remains one of the most innovative companies in the world - Anusha Shanmugarajah

Hackathons are not just for engineers. In fact it’s better if they are not. Shopify did a hackathon soon after the lockdown to encourage everyone to find ideas and improve working digitally with each other. That’s how you get lots of innovative ideas that come from anyone, not just engineers. That’s an innovative culture.
